Output 2429de80865ab85157a6f0426eb415c0ee030408016f53593b67d65f650eef2d:1

value
6073153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67757323225faf74a36293405f9236086f5e4f59 OP_EQUAL
address
3B84DrWBTVnyfM2GKQof7c4hQUMz6njmid
transaction
2429de80865ab85157a6f0426eb415c0ee030408016f53593b67d65f650eef2d
confirmations
261325
spent
true